Scottish Lochs: Remote Paddling Paradise

Scotland’s extensive loch system represents some of Europe’s finest kayaking territory. The best kayaking routes UK nomads trend digest consistently highlights Scottish destinations for their dramatic landscapes and accessibility. Loch Ness offers iconic paddling with stunning Highland scenery, while Loch Morar provides a more secluded experience for those seeking solitude. The interconnected Caledonian Canal system allows multi-day expeditions, perfect for nomads planning extended stays.

Loch Katrine near Stirling combines accessibility with breathtaking mountain views, making it ideal for intermediate paddlers. The water remains relatively calm, and the surrounding landscape provides excellent camping opportunities for nomadic adventurers. Loch Lomond, Scotland’s largest freshwater body, offers diverse paddling options from gentle shoreline exploration to more challenging open-water crossings.

Welsh Rivers and Coastal Routes

Wales delivers some of Britain’s most exhilarating kayaking experiences. The River Wye forms a natural border between Wales and England, offering stunning gorge paddling with limestone cliffs towering overhead. This route suits intermediate to advanced paddlers seeking technical challenges combined with scenic beauty. Coastal kayaking around Pembrokeshire provides dramatic sea paddling with sea caves, hidden beaches, and abundant marine wildlife. The Gower Peninsula offers sheltered bays perfect for beginners, while more experienced paddlers can tackle open-water crossings between islands. These routes work exceptionally well for nomads planning week-long explorations with flexible schedules.

English Lake District and Beyond

The Lake District remains England’s premier kayaking destination. Windermere, England’s largest lake, offers excellent facilities and diverse paddling options. Coniston Water and Ullswater provide equally compelling experiences with fewer crowds. Beyond the Lakes, the Norfolk Broads present entirely different paddling experiences. These shallow waterways wind through peaceful countryside, offering leisurely exploration perfect for nomads seeking relaxation between work sessions. The Broads’ gentle nature suits all skill levels and provides excellent opportunities for wildlife observation.

Essential Kayaking Route Categories

  • Mountain lake routes offering dramatic scenery and moderate paddling challenges
  • Coastal sea kayaking expeditions with tidal considerations and marine exploration
  • River paddling routes ranging from gentle flowing waters to technical whitewater sections
  • Canal systems providing calm, accessible paddling through historic landscapes
  • Estuary routes combining freshwater and saltwater paddling experiences

Seasonal Considerations and Best Times to Paddle

UK kayaking seasons vary significantly by location and water type. Scottish lochs remain paddleable year-round, though winter conditions demand advanced skills and specialized equipment. Spring brings warming temperatures and increased daylight, making it ideal for nomads planning extended paddling expeditions. Summer offers the most accessible conditions with longest daylight hours, though popular routes become crowded.

Autumn delivers stunning scenery with fewer crowds, making it attractive for nomadic adventurers seeking solitude. Water temperatures drop considerably, requiring appropriate wetsuits and safety precautions. Winter paddling suits only experienced kayakers with specialized training and equipment.
